- The Sony BRAVIA XR A90J 4K HDR OLED with Smart Google TV is one of the best TVs ever made. The 83" XR83A90J is the first OLED in the USA to have a heatsink, HDMI 2.1 gaming, and pushes over 1000 nits. But do these upgrades justify the cost for this Master Series OLED? I'll offer the top 4 features as well as differences from the smaller sizes and then I'll show SDR, HDR and gaming content before making buying recommendations that include the LG C1, LG C1, Samsung QN90a, and the Sony A80J. #XR83A90J #A90J
